Frequently asked questions

What is the latest spending data available for City of Wolverhampton Council?

The most recent spending data we have available for City of Wolverhampton Council is from June 2026. Government departments and public bodies typically publish their spending data on a monthly or quarterly basis.

How has City of Wolverhampton Council's spending changed over time?

City of Wolverhampton Council's spending has decreased over time. In 2026, they spent £114,095,751, compared to £438,551,658 in 2025 - a decrease of 74.0%.

How much does City of Wolverhampton Council spend on suppliers?

City of Wolverhampton Council has spent a total of £2,197,329,834 on suppliers according to our records. This spending is distributed across 8130 suppliers.
